What Is a Freezone Anyway?

A freezone is a special business area in Dubai.

Each freezone is built for certain types of businesses. There are over 30 freezones in Dubai. That’s why you need to choose carefully.

When you open a company in a freezone, you get full control. You can own 100% of your business. No local sponsor is needed.

And that’s a big deal.

You also get tax benefits. No personal tax. No corporate tax (until a certain income level). No import/export tax inside the freezone.

But to work legally, you need a Dubai freezone license.

The 3 Main Types of Freezone Licenses

Let’s keep this very clear.

Most Dubai freezone licenses fall into these 3 types:

  1. Trading License
    For businesses that buy and sell goods. This includes import and export. If you’re selling clothes, electronics, food, or anything physical, this license is for you.
  2. Service License
    For companies that offer services. This includes consulting, IT, marketing, education, and more. If you sell skills, not products, this is your fit.
  3. Industrial License
    For businesses that make or manufacture things. If you want to build a factory or do production, go with this.

Each Dubai freezone license is tied to your business activity. So you need to match the license with what you do.

How Much Does It Cost?

Let’s talk numbers. On average:

  • A basic freezone license in Dubai costs around AED 12,500 to AED 25,000 per year
  • If you include office space and visa quota, the total package may cost AED 30,000 or more
  • You can start with flexi-desk options to keep costs low

Different freezones offer different prices. Some are more premium. Some are budget-friendly.

If you’re just starting, it’s smart to begin with the most affordable option that suits your needs.

Which Freezone Should You Choose?

Here’s a quick guide based on your business type:

  • Dubai Multi Commodities Centre (DMCC): Best for trading, especially gold, diamonds, and tea. Also popular for crypto businesses.
  • Dubai Internet City: Perfect for tech and software firms.
  • Dubai Media City: Ideal for media, marketing, publishing.
  • Dubai Healthcare City: If you’re in health or wellness, this is your place.
  • Dubai Silicon Oasis: Good for IT and electronics startups.

Each of these offers a Dubai freezone license tailored to those industries.

So don’t choose by name. Choose by fit.

Can You Get a Visa With It?

Yes. Most Dubai freezone licenses include visa options.

You can apply for your own visa. You can sponsor employees. You can even sponsor your family.

The number of visas you get depends on the package and the office size.

Even small packages usually allow at least 1 or 2 visas.

Can You Work With Companies Outside the Freezone?

Here’s something most people don’t know.

If you open a business in a freezone, you can work with international clients easily. But working inside the Dubai mainland has some limits.

If most of your clients are in mainland Dubai, then a mainland license might be better.

Still, many businesses start with a Dubai freezone license because it’s cheaper and faster.

Later, they expand to the mainland.

What Documents Do You Need?

Getting a license is easy if your papers are ready.

Here’s what you usually need:

  • Passport copies
  • Passport-size photo
  • Business name options
  • A short description of what your business does

Some freezones may ask for more. But many don’t.

Setup time can be as quick as 3 to 5 working days once papers are clear.
